EC: Solvency II Implementing Regulations
The following have been published in the Official Journal: (i) Commission Implementing Regulation (EU) 2023/894 of 4 April 2023 laying down implementing technical standards for the application of Solvency II with regard to the templates for the submission by insurance and reinsurance undertakings to their supervisory authorities of information necessary for their supervision and repealing Implementing Regulation (EU) 2015/2450; (ii) Commission Implementing Regulation (EU) 2023/895 of 4 April 2023 laying down implementing technical standards for the application of Solvency II with regard to the procedures, formats and templates for the disclosure by insurance and reinsurance undertakings of their report on their solvency and financial condition and repealing Implementing Regulation (EU) 2015/2452.
